1. The Kitchen Island

Most new homes have a kitchen island. It is functional, practical and looks nice.

However, if you have an older home, you probably think you don’t have enough room for an island.

There are now kitchen plans that incorporate the islands as peninsulas first, then they can be rolled into the middle of the room when needed. This design gives the much- wanted workspace, yet allows for better traffic flow when not in use.

With this style of the island, you can still choose your countertop materials, electrical outlets and seating, as long as you keep in mind the entire structure is moveable.

 

2. The Kitchen Backsplash

This is the tile placed between the countertop and the cabinets. In older homes, this was simply painted to match the color scheme of the kitchen or left white. But today, there are so many different colors, patterns and materials to fill that space with more personality.

The backsplash should match the color of the entire kitchen, or you can choose one color out of many to highlight. This is the area that can be bold and makes your kitchen pop.

Think about regular red brick, shiny metals and floral patterns that will give the kitchen that extra “pop” and bring it into the modern era.

 

3. Kitchen Colors

Don’t shy away from color in the kitchen. You don’t have to have a natural wood-look when it comes to cabinets, chairs and curtains. Think about mixing and matching colors like green and purple or yellow and red. Have one main color and the other as an accent.

If you don’t want to be so bold, pick one color for the countertops and walls. Then add dark purple chairs or curtains for a bit of splash of color.

 

4. Kitchen Lighting Ideas

Today’s modern and updated kitchen has moved away from the traditional ceiling lights that look as if they belong in the garage.

Pendant lights, hanging lights, and modest chandeliers are all options for a newly redesigned kitchen. Under-the-cabinet lighting is also an option, one that is often overlooked but always needed.
